What to Expect When Hiring a Digital Marketing Agency for Your Small Business

Running a small business today means operating in a marketplace that never sleeps. Customers are searching, scrolling, and comparing brands around the clock. To keep up, you need more than a website or social media page — you need a strategy that connects your business to the right audience, at the right time, with the right message.

For many small businesses, hiring a digital marketing agency is the most efficient way to do that. But what should you really expect when bringing in an external team? Understanding the process, the partnership, and the long-term value will help you make smarter decisions and get the most from your investment.

1. It Starts with Understanding, Not Selling

The first thing a good agency does isn’t pitching services — it’s asking questions. They take time to understand your business goals, audience behavior, and the challenges you’re facing.

This stage often includes market research, competitor analysis, and website or social media audits. You’ll discuss your target demographics, customer journey, and what success looks like for your brand.

By building a clear understanding from the start, the agency ensures that every campaign they design aligns with your real objectives. This discovery process separates true partners from vendors who simply offer packages without context.

2. Building a Strategy That Fits Your Growth Stage

Once your goals are clear, the agency begins crafting a custom strategy — one that fits your size, market, and resources.

A strong digital strategy combines various channels and techniques that work together to deliver measurable outcomes. Search engine optimization (SEO) might be the foundation, ensuring people can find your business when they search online. Pay-per-click (PPC) campaigns can deliver faster visibility and leads. Content marketing and social media build trust and engagement, while web development ensures your site converts visitors into customers.

An experienced agency won’t throw every service at you; instead, they’ll recommend what makes sense for your stage of growth. They’ll focus on sustainable, cost-effective tactics that help you compete with larger players — without draining your budget.

6. Setting Realistic Expectations

It’s important to approach digital marketing with the right mindset. Results take time, especially for organic growth through SEO and content marketing. While paid ads may deliver immediate visibility, true brand authority builds gradually through consistency.

A responsible agency will help you set realistic milestones — explaining what can be achieved in the first few months and what progress to expect over six months or a year. They’ll measure success through meaningful metrics like lead quality, engagement, and return on investment rather than vanity numbers.

Honesty at this stage builds trust and helps you stay patient through the process of sustainable growth.

9. Choosing the Right Agency

Selecting the right agency takes time. Beyond pricing and packages, focus on expertise, transparency, and cultural fit. You want a team that listens first, customizes strategies, and explains their reasoning clearly.

Look at their past results, client reviews, and how they communicate. A good agency will prioritize understanding your business before promising outcomes. They’ll speak in clear, actionable language — not buzzwords — and give you a realistic view of what’s possible.
